So, how do you choose? Start by listing what you do most: is it mobile check deposits, paying bills, or sending money to family? Test the mobile apps; most banks offer demos or highly rated apps you can preview. Consider your need for cash. While online banking reduces branch visits, having fee-free access to local ATMs still matters. Envision Credit Union and Capital City Bank participate in shared local networks, while Bank of America offers its own widespread machines. Finally, don't underestimate the value of local customer service. A quick phone call to a Quincy branch with a digital banking question can solve issues faster than a national helpline.
